Building the phylogenies
• Searched and raided GenBank with species lists using Gene finder python script (Ron Lanfear)
• Used three best sampled plas=d markers – rbcL, matK, ndhF
• Aligned sequences and concatenated – Maff-‐T and Sequencematrix
• Analyses in CIPRES portal using RAxML Blackbox

Phylogene=c Endemism
Australia: 34.6% of the tree for 86.87% of the area (cells) PNG: 5% of the tree for 11.2% of the area NCal: 11.26% of the tree for 1.9% of the area
